About the Movement?

Running to Stop the Traffik is a student-run initiative aiming to stop human trafficking and slavery around the world through an endurance type sports event that raises money for charity. It is a subsidiary event organized by the Youth Endurance Network, a platform by young people for young people, nurturing creativity, leadership skills, and uniting young people with a passion for changing the world, impacting this planet one project at a time. Running to Stop the Traffik represents an endeavour to bring endurance running and raising awareness for human trafficking together, reflecting our aspirations for a better and brighter future. The 24 Hour Race is our first attempt at philanthropy through endurance, a 24 hour endurance type event aiming to empower students to support charities endeared to them while participating in something that they love.
